The Philippine Department of Public Works and Highways aims to restore roads of up to 31,230km during the 2012 financial year.
April 24, 2012
Read time: 1 min
The Philippines 2569 Department of Public Works and Highways aims to restore roads of up to 31,230km during the 2012 financial year.